#6bb284 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6bb284 is composed of 42% red, 69.8% green and 51.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 39.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 25.8% yellow and 30.2% black. It has a hue angle of 141.1 degrees, a saturation of 31.6% and a lightness of 55.9%. #6bb284 color hex could be obtained by blending #d6ffff with #006509. Closest websafe color is: #669999.

Shades and Tints of #6bb284

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040705 is the darkest color, while #f9fcfa is the lightest one.
